Leenalchi

Leenalchi are currently enjoying viral success with the video ‘Feel the Rhythm of Korea’, in collaboration with the Ambiguous Dance Company and the Korean Tourism Organisation, the video on YouTube has been seen over 27 million times.

Deconstructing and re-arranging traditional elements, with inspiration from 80’s new wave that you can’t help but move to, the group boasts four traditional vocalists: Song Hee Kwon, Yu Jin Shin, Yi Ho Ahn and Na Rae Lee, who deliver musical storytelling through solos, choir, rapping and dance. The band also features a drummer Chul Hee Lee and two bassists: Young Gyu Jang and Jung Yeop Jeong.

Bassist Jang’s previous credits include films Gokseong and Train to Busan, as well as being a member of Uhuhboo Project (who performed at K-Music 2013) and SsingSsing who opened the 2018 K-Music Festival to a sold-out crowd.

The performance Leenalchi will present for K-Music Critics’ Choice is about their first album, Sugungga, which is a pansori piece which consists of musical storytelling by a vocalist and a drummer. The performance was recorded at the Yeowoorak Festival hosted by the National Theater of Korea.
